Output 7121067859c1d78ededc1aefbbdb708a951b6714c5933b6316076abc3221e8c6:1
- value
- 356526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8eb27504ee68360527e1605812510c7baafae89d OP_EQUAL
- address
- 3EhXfCbmvDL9hXzLATd2bXmB1rwYf6wr8T
- transaction
- 7121067859c1d78ededc1aefbbdb708a951b6714c5933b6316076abc3221e8c6
- confirmations
- 193656
- spent
- true